2. Key Vital Signs
Metric | Value | Interpretation |
---|---|---|
Account Category | Dormant | No significant financial transactions; company is inactive. |
Net Assets | £1 | Extremely minimal asset base, indicating no operational assets. |
Shareholders Funds | £1 | Equity is minimal, reflecting no retained earnings or capital growth. |
Cash | £1 | No working cash flow; effectively no liquidity. |
Filing Status | Up to date | Compliance with filing deadlines, a positive administrative sign. |
Number of Directors | 2 | Active governance structure in place. |
Industry Classification (SIC) | 68209 | Real estate letting operations, but currently inactive. |
